About This Item

Boston:: Houghton Mifflin., 2004.. SIGNED first edition -. Near fine in stiff wrappers.. First printing, a trade paperback, issued simultaneously with hardcover. An anthology from magazines in the US and Canada published in 1987. Introduction by Moore. SIGNED by TWO contributors: T. C. Boyle at his story 'Tooth and Claw' and Sarah Shun-Lien Bynum at "Accomplice." Also includes stories by Sherman Alexie, Jill McCorkle, Thomas McGuane, Edward P. Jones, Annie Proulx, Alice Munro, John Updike, John Edgar Wideman and more. Notes on the contributors, a listing of other distinguished stories, and information on the magazines. Series editor Katrina Kenison. xxii, 462 pp
